The table below looks at the prevalence of the term Finance in contract job vacancies in the South East. Included is a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ered in vacancies that cited Finance over the 6 months leading up to 12 June 2024,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
12 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 9 5 4
Rank change year-on-year -4 -1 +4
Contract jobs citing Finance 677 870 1,253
As % of all contract jobs advertised in the South East 11.77% 15.36% 16.36%
As % of the General category 23.75% 26.40% 29.46%
Number of daily rates quoted 381 622 900
10th Percentile £213 £213 £324
25th Percentile £363 £413 £425
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£500 £525 £513
Median % change year-on-year -4.76% +2.44% +7.89%
75th Percentile £613 £655 £615
90th Percentile £725 £755 £676
England median daily rate £588 £600 £575
% change year-on-year -2.08% +4.35% +9.52%
